Cutting-Edge Diagnostic Tools
Early diagnosis is key in preventing or managing eye diseases. Traditional eye exams have evolved into more sophisticated procedures thanks to technology. Dr. modi hospital employs state-of-the-art diagnostic tools that offer higher accuracy and better insight into the patient’s condition.
One such tool is the OCT (Optical Coherence Tomography) scanner, which produces high-resolution images of the retina and optic nerve. This non-invasive method helps detect early signs of conditions like glaucoma, macular degeneration, and diabetic retinopathy. The ability to examine the retina layer by layer allows Dr. Modi to identify abnormalities that may not be visible through traditional exams.
Additionally, digital retinal photography provides detailed images of the eye’s interior, enabling Dr. Modi to monitor the progression of eye diseases with remarkable precision. These images are stored digitally, allowing for easy comparison during follow-up visits, ensuring that no change is overlooked.
Laser-Assisted Precision in Surgery
When it comes to surgery, Dr. Modi understands that precision is critical. Laser technology has transformed the way many eye surgeries are performed, allowing for minimally invasive procedures that minimize discomfort and reduce recovery times. At McModiEyeHospital, advanced Femtosecond Laser Technology is used in cataract surgeries to offer greater accuracy and reduce complications.
This technology uses laser pulses to break up the cataract and fragment it into smaller pieces before removal. The procedure is quicker and less traumatic compared to traditional methods, leading to faster recovery and fewer side effects for the patient. The high precision of the femtosecond laser allows Dr. Modi to achieve better visual outcomes with a reduced risk of complications.
In addition to cataract surgery, laser technology is also used for refractive surgeries like LASIK (Laser-Assisted in Situ Keratomileusis). LASIK is a popular procedure to correct n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. Using the latest Excimer laser systems, Dr. Modi can reshape the cornea with unparalleled precision, restoring vision and reducing dependence on glasses or contact lenses.

Artificial Intelligence and Predictive Analytics
Artificial intelligence (AI) and predictive analytics have made their way into the ophthalmology field, and Dr. Modi has embraced these advancements to improve diagnosis accuracy and patient care. A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of medical data to predict the likelihood of developing certain eye conditions, even before symptoms appear.
At McModiEyeHospital, AI-powered tools help Dr. Modi assess a patient’s risk of diseases such as glaucoma or age-related macular degeneration based on factors like family history, genetics, and lifestyle. By identifying at-risk individuals early, Dr. Modi can implement preventive measures or initiate early treatment to slow disease progression.
